The trial that was due to start at Perth Sheriff Court yesterday, relating to a Scottish gamekeeper accused of killing a Goshawk, has been delayed.
The case didn’t call yesterday due to another trial over-running. The next available court date is not until March 2026.
This case relates to the alleged killing of a Goshawk on a shooting estate near Blairgowrie on 12 February 2024.
